Why These Are the Top General Auto Repair Auto Repair Shops in Watkinsville

The general auto repair market in Watkinsville, Georgia, is characterized by a handful of highly-rated, independent shops that thrive on reputation and long-term community relationships. As part of Oconee County, the market is competitive but not oversaturated, with a focus on quality and trust over high-volume, low-cost services. The average shop rating is notably high (often 4.5 stars and above), reflecting a community that values and recognizes reliable service. Typical pricing is moderate and in line with regional standards; labor rates are generally lower than in the nearby metropolitan area of Atlanta but are competitive within the Athens-Clarke County metro area. Customers can expect a personal touch and shops that invest in modern diagnostic equipment to handle a wide array of vehicle makes and models.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about general auto repair services in Watkinsville, GA

What are the most common auto repairs needed by drivers in Watkinsville due to local conditions?

Given our rural roads and occasional red clay dust, common repairs include suspension work (shocks/struts), brake services due to hilly terrain, and air filter replacements. Vehicles also frequently need AC system repairs and checks to handle Georgia's hot, humid summers effectively.

How can I find a trustworthy, local auto repair shop in Watkinsville?

Look for shops with strong local reputations, often family-owned, and check for certifications like ASE. Reading reviews from other Oconee County residents and asking for recommendations at community hubs like the Watkinsville Post Office or Farmers Market can lead you to reliable, established mechanics.

When should I seek service for my car's air conditioning in the Watkinsville area?

You should have your AC system checked in early spring, before the intense summer heat arrives. This proactive service is crucial locally to ensure your system can handle months of consistent use and to identify refrigerant leaks or compressor issues common in older vehicles.

Are auto repair prices in Watkinsville generally higher than in nearby Athens?

Prices in Watkinsville are often competitive and can be comparable to Athens, though you may find slightly lower labor rates at some independent shops. The value often comes from personalized service, convenience, and supporting a local Oconee County business without the drive into the city.

What local factors should I consider when scheduling brake service in Watkinsville?

Consider our area's rolling hills, stop-and-go traffic on 441/Route 15, and wet weather. These conditions accelerate brake wear. Schedule an inspection if you hear noises, feel pulsation, or before long trips to the North Georgia mountains to ensure safe stopping power on steep grades.
